A ball with mass m1 moving at +5.0 m/s, collides head-on with a stationary ball of mass m2 = 280 grams. The collision is perfectly elastic. The ball with mass m1 rebounds with a velocity v1 = -3.0 m/s. What is the mass m1 of the first ball?
